Mission

To produce and/or broadcast educational television programs to viewing area of west central minnesota.

Programs

3 programs

Broadcasting and production-production of programs and switching of information over various broadcast facilities.

Expenses: $854K

Engineering-development and maintenance of production and transmission systems.

Expenses: $1.4M
